South Pointe and Northwestern faced off in a cross-town battle on Monday. The Stallions came up short against the Trojans, falling 3-0.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Trojans this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 3-1 back in August.
The final score came out to 25-14, 25-13, 25-19.
South Pointe's loss was their fourth stra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 4-12. As for Northwestern, their win ended a three-match drought at home and bumped them up to 7-12.
